Overview

The Online MA in English is a prestigious postgraduate program that offers a profound exploration of the human experience through the lens of literature. Over four semesters, you will move beyond foundational reading to engage with complex literary theories, socio-political contexts, and the evolving nature of the English language. This program is delivered through a sophisticated digital learning environment, featuring interactive seminars and recorded masterclasses from renowned literary scholars. Whether you are aiming for a career in academia, publishing, or high-level corporate communication, this degree cultivates the sophisticated analytical skills and eloquent expression required to lead in the knowledge economy.

Career Opportunities

An MA in English is a highly versatile credential that signals intellectual depth and superior communication skills.

  • Assistant Professor / Lecturer (Post NET/SET)

  • Editorial Director / Senior Editor

  • Content Strategist & Creative Lead

  • Corporate Communications Manager

  • Journalist & Feature Writer

  • Instructional Designer

  • Public Relations (PR) Director

Certification & Recognition

Upon completion, you will be awarded a Master of Arts (English) degree. Fully entitled by the University Grants Commission (UGC), this degree is globally recognized for doctoral applications, international teaching assignments, and high-level corporate recruitment.
